property modifierExtension as HS.FHIRModel.R4.SeqOfExtension;
May be used to represent additional information that is not part
of the basic definition of the element and that modifies the understanding
of the element in which it is contained and/or the understanding
of the containing element's descendants. Usually modifier elements
provide negation or qualification. To make the use of extensions
safe and manageable, there is a strict set of governance applied
to the definition and use of extensions. Though any implementer
can define an extension, there is a set of requirements that SHALL
be met as part of the definition of the extension. Applications
processing a resource are required to check for modifier extensions. Modifier
extensions SHALL NOT change the meaning of any elements on Resource
or DomainResource (including cannot change the meaning of modifierExtension
itself).
